
My friend Dion is from Indonesia, and he makes the most delicious Indonesian food imaginable. Here are some fabulous Tofu Dumplings that he’s just steamed.
For the filling, mash together some organic tofu, minced garlic and fresh chopped mushrooms, preferably some deliciously decadent shiitake. Then assemble the dumplings by simply getting a little square of raw pasta, spooning a dollop of filling in the middle, and then pinching the pasta to loosely seal it.
Pop them all into a bamboo steamer, put the lid on tightly, dangle above a pan of boiling water, and get ready for amazing dumplings within a few minutes.
